南开大学22春“计算机科学与技术”《Windows可视化编程》离线作业(一)辅导答案12

上传人:住在山****ck 文档编号:107233568 上传时间:2022-06-14 格式:DOCX 页数:7 大小:22.55KB
收藏 版权申诉 举报 下载
南开大学22春“计算机科学与技术”《Windows可视化编程》离线作业(一)辅导答案12_第1页
第1页 / 共7页
南开大学22春“计算机科学与技术”《Windows可视化编程》离线作业(一)辅导答案12_第2页
第2页 / 共7页
南开大学22春“计算机科学与技术”《Windows可视化编程》离线作业(一)辅导答案12_第3页
第3页 / 共7页
资源描述:

《南开大学22春“计算机科学与技术”《Windows可视化编程》离线作业(一)辅导答案12》由会员分享,可在线阅读,更多相关《南开大学22春“计算机科学与技术”《Windows可视化编程》离线作业(一)辅导答案12(7页珍藏版)》请在装配图网上搜索。

1、书山有路勤为径,学海无涯苦作舟! 住在富人区的她南开大学22春“计算机科学与技术”Windows可视化编程离线作业(一)辅导答案一.综合考核(共50题)1.使用下列哪种方法可以减少一个ArrayList对象的容量?()A.调用Remove方法B.调用Clear方法C.调用Trim/ToSize方法D.设置Capacity属性参考答案:CD2.Windows_Form应用程序中,要求下压按钮控件Button1有以下特性:正常情况下,该按钮是扁平的,当鼠标指针移动到它上面时,按钮升高。那么,在程序中,属性Button1.FlatStyle的值应设定为()A.System.Windows.Forms

2、.FlatStyle.FlatB.System.Windows.Form.FlatStyle.PopupC.System.Windows.Forms.FlatStyle.StandardD.System.Windows.Forms.FlatStyle.System参考答案:B3.如果将窗体的FormBoderStyle设置为None,则()。A.窗体没有边框并不能调整大小B.窗体没有边框但能调整大小C.窗体有边框但不能调整大小D.窗体是透明的参考答案:B4.面向对象编程的三大特征是()。A.继承B.多态C.封装D.统一接口参考答案:ABC5.()对象的AcceptButton属性被使用响应选定

3、的某个特殊按钮的单击事件。A.按钮B.窗体C.键盘D.鼠标参考答案:B6.显示消息框时,MessageBoxIcon枚举中的Error成员可在消息框中添加一个图标,该图标的形状是()A.iB.?C.XD.!参考答案:C7.在控制台程序必须有一个static_void_Main(),下列关于这个方法的描述中,哪些是正确的?()A.必须在结构或类的内部B.声明Main()方法时既可以使用参数,也可以不使用C.这方法不可以有返回类型D.这个方法叫做入口点函数参考答案:ABCD8.try块的嵌套工作方式有哪几种情况?参考答案:static void Main(string args)/* 嵌套try块

4、bai* try* * /A* try* * /B* * catch* * /C* * finally* * /D* * /E* * catch* . * finally* . * 抛出异常在:内层A,E处由外层ducatch块捕获,并执行zhi外层finally* 抛出异常在:内层B处,且有一合适dao内层catch捕获,执行内层finally,后执行E处* rn抛出异常在:内层B处,但内层catch块没有合适处理程序,执行内层finally,搜索外层catch,找合适的,执行外层finally,此时不会执行E* 抛出异常在:内层C处,退出内层catch块,执行内层finally,搜索外层c

5、atch,找到合适,执行外层finally* 抛出异常在:内层D处,退出内层finally块,搜索外层catch,找到合适,执行外层finally*/* 使用嵌套块的原因:* 1.修改所抛出的异常类型* 2.在代码的不同地方处理不同类型的异常*/9.自定义组件(名词解释)参考答案:在开发的过程中,既定的组件往往不能满足实际需求,此时,我们需要使用自定义组件的方法适应需求。10.以下哪个是可以变长的数组()A.ArrayB.stringC.stringND.ArrayList参考答案:D11.要创建多文档应用程序,需要将窗体的()属性设为true。A.DrawGridB.ShowInTaskba

6、rC.EnabledD.IsMdiContainer参考答案:D12.C#中,新建一个字符串变量str,并将字符串Toms_Living_Room保存到串中,应该()A.string str=Toms_Living_Room;B.string str=Toms_Living_Room;C.string str(Toms_Living_Room);D.string str(Toms_Living_Room);参考答案:A13.什么属性用来设置某个控件为三维或平的?()A.DimensionB.FlatC.BorderStyleD.Fixed参考答案:C14.如何将控件停靠到窗体的右边?()A.b

7、utton1.Dock=DockStyle.Right;B.button1.Dock=Right;C.button1.Anchor=AnchorStyles.Right;D.button1.Anchor=Right;参考答案:A15.在Windows Forms程序中,某CheckBox对象初始化为三态(即:其ThreeState属性值为true)。则应使用()属性来检查此CheckBox的状态。A.IsSelectedB.CheckStateC.CheckedD.State参考答案:C16.C#程序中,需要对一个数组中的所有元素进行处理,则使用()循环体最好。A.whileB.foreach

8、C.doD.for参考答案:B17.在C#中设计类时,如何将一个可读可写的公有属性Name修改为只读属性?()A.将Name的set块删除B.将Name的set块置空C.将Name的set块前加修饰符privateD.将Name添加readonly修饰符参考答案:A18.在VS.NET窗口中,在()窗口中可以查看当前项目的类和类型的层次信息。A.解决方案资源管理器B.类视图C.资源视图D.属性参考答案:B19.C#中,新建一个字符串变量str,并将字符串Toms_Living_Room保存到串中,应该()A.string str=Toms_Living_Room;B.string str=To

9、ms_Living_Room;C.string str(Toms_Living_Room);D.string str(Toms_Living_Room);参考答案:A20.变量menuItem1引用一个菜单项对象,为隐藏该菜单项,应进行何种操作?()A.menuItem1.Visible=falseB.menuItem1.Enabled=falseC.menuItem1.Text=“”D.menuItem1.Checked=false参考答案:A21.什么字符被用来放在其他字符串末尾使这些字符串连成一串?()A.?B.-C.+D.*参考答案:A22.创建项目后,希望在当前项目中加入一个Wind

10、ows_Form界面,以下哪些方法可以实现?()A.点击“文件”,选择子菜单中的“新建”再选择“项目”B.点击“文件”,选择子菜单中的“打开”,再选择“项目”C.在解决方案资源管理器中,右键当前项目,选择“添加”,再选择“新项目”D.使用类视图,右键后选择“添加”,再选择“类”参考答案:CD23.如何将控件停靠到窗体的右边?()A.button1.Dock=DockStyle.RightB.button1.Dock=RightC.button1.Anchor=AnchorStyles.RightD.button1.Anchor=Right参考答案:A24.变量openFileDialog1引用

11、一个OpenFileDialog对象。为检查用户在退出对话框时时否点击了“打开”按钮,应检查openFileDialog1.ShowDialog()的返回值是否等于()A.DialogResult.OKB.DialogResult.YesC.DialogResult.NoD.DialogResult.Cancel参考答案:A25.在C#中设计类时,应如何保证在释放对象的所有引用之前,释放对象使用的文件、网络等资源?()A.为类重载new运算符B.为类添加析构函数,在析构函数中释放资源C.为类添加delete运算符D.为实现IDisposable借口参考答案:BD26.请问经过表达式a=3+15

12、?0:1的运算,变量a的最终值是什么?()A.3B.1C.0D.4参考答案:B27.()命名空间中的类和接口用于创建Web应用程序的页面?A.System.DrawingB.System.IOC.System.Web.UID.System.Web.Service参考答案:C28.下列关于C#中索引器理解正确的是()A.索引器的参数必须是两个或两个以上B.索引器的参数类型必须是整数型C.索引器没有名字D.以上皆非参考答案:C29.在C#中,预处理指令#region和#endregion的作用是()A.注释#region和#endregion之间的代码B.为Code_Editor定义一段可折叠代码

13、区C.#region和#endregion之间的代码在Debug版本中不参加编译D.#region和#endregion之间的代码在Release版本中不参加编译参考答案:B30.使用VS.NET的新建C#项目创建一个名为“Simple的Windows”表单应用程序,则在生成()文件中可以设置该程序集的Copyright/Trademark等属性信息。A.Form1.resxB.SimpleForm.slnC.SimpleForm.csprojD.AssemblyInfo.cs参考答案:D31.在VS.NET窗口中,()窗口提供了连接到本地或远程计算机上数据库并进行管理的功能。A.工具箱B.资

14、源管理C.解决方案资源管理器D.服务器资源管理器参考答案:D32.Net依赖以下哪项技术实现跨语言互用性?()A.CLRB.CTSC.CLSD.CTT参考答案:C33.在Stack类中,移除并返回栈顶元素的方法是()。A.DequeueB.PeekC.PushD.Pop参考答案:D34.C#可以采用以下哪些技术来实现对象内部数据的隐藏?()A.静态成员B.类成员的访问控制说明C.属性D.装箱和拆箱技术参考答案:BC35.C#中,新建一个字符串变量str,并将字符串“Toms_Living_Room”保存到串中,应该()A.string str=“Toms_Living_Room”;B.stri

15、ng str=“Toms_Living_Room”;C.string str(“Toms_Living_Room”);D.string str(“Tom“s_Living_Room”);参考答案:B36.C#中每个char类型量占用()个字节的内容。A.1B.2C.4D.8参考答案:B37.TCP服务器(名词解释)参考答案:TCP(Transmission Control Protocol rn传输控制协议)是一种面向连接的、可靠的、基于字节流的传输层通信协议,由IETF的RFC rn793定义。在简化的计算机网络OSI模型中,它完成第四层传输层所指定的功能,用户数据报协议(UDP)是同一层内

16、另一个重要的传输协议。在因特网协议族(Internet rnprotocol rnsuite)中,TCP层是位于IP层之上,应用层之下的中间层。不同主机的应用层之间经常需要可靠的、像管道一样的连接,但是IP层不提供这样的流机制,而是提供不可靠的包交换。38.Winform中,关于ToolBar控件的属性和事件的描述不正确的是()。A.Buttons属性表示ToolBar控件的所有工具栏按钮B.ButtonSize属性表示ToolBar控件上的工具栏按钮的大小,如高度和宽度C.DropDownArrows属性表明工具栏按钮(该按钮有一列值需要以下拉方式显示)旁边是否显示下箭头键D.ButtonC

17、lick事件在用户单击工具栏任何地方时都会触发参考答案:D39.PictureBox控件(名词解释)参考答案:PictureBox控件可以显示来自位图、图标或者元文件,以及来自增强的元文件、JPEG或 GIF文件的图形。如果控件不足以显示整幅图象,则裁剪图象以适应控件的大小。40.在窗体Form1中有按钮Button1,以下哪个Click事件处理程序可以关闭该窗体?()A.Form1.Close();B.this.Close();C.Button1.Close();D.me.Close();参考答案:B41.NET提供的管理常用数据结构的List.Quese.HashTable等类是直接包含在

18、()命名空间中的。A.System.DataB.System.IOC.System.CollectionsD.System参考答案:C42.如果设treeView1=new_TreeView(),则treeView1.Nodes.Add(根节点)返回的是一个()类型的值。A.TreeNodeB.intC.stringD.TreeView参考答案:A43.在为自定义类取名时,Microsoft推荐使用的命名规范是()A.Hungarian_notationB.随便起名字C.CamelD.Pascal参考答案:D44.Win中,关于ToolBar控件的属性和事件的描述不正确的是()。A.Butto

19、ns属性表示ToolBar控件的所有工具栏按钮B.ButtonSize属性表示ToolBar控件上的工具栏按钮的大小,如高度和宽度C.DropDownArrows属性表明工具栏按钮(该按钮有一列值需要以下拉方式显示)旁边是否显示下箭头键D.ButtonClick事件在用户单击工具栏任何地方时都会触发参考答案:D45.在类的定义中,类的描述了该类的对象的行为特征。A.类名B.方法C.所属的名字空间D.私有域参考答案:B46.设置openfiledialog1引用一个openfiledialog 对象。则打开该对话框的正确代码是()A.openfiledialog1.show();B.openfi

20、ledialog1.showdialog();C.openfiledialog1.open();D.openfiledialog1.openandshow();参考答案:B47.“访问范围限定于此程序或那些由它所属的类派生的类型”是对以下哪个成员可访问性含义的正确描述?()A.publicB.protectedC.internalD.protected_internal参考答案:D48.c#可以采用以下哪些技术来实现对象内部数据的隐藏?()A.静态成员B.装箱和拆箱技术C.类成员的访问控制说明D.属性参考答案:CD49.在C#中,选项卡式控件是()类的实例。A.TableB.TabpagesC.TabpageD.TabControl参考答案:D50.在为自定义类取名时,Microsoft推荐使用的命名规范是()。A.Hungarian_notationB.随便起名字C.CamelD.Pascal参考答案:D

展开阅读全文
温馨提示:
1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
2: 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
3.本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服 - 联系我们

cop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!